Job Summary:
The VP, Learning provides strategic leadership over WealthCounsel’s Learning programs, ensuring the development and delivery of high quality, relevant substantive education to members and prospective members and supporting members in building and growing successful law practices. Drawing on deep expertise in estate planning and law practice development, the VP, Learning ensures the quality, relevance, and strategic growth of WealthCounsel's educational and practice development offerings. This position reports to the Chief Content Officer (CCO).
As a VP, Learning, your responsibilities include:
- Provides strategic leadership to the Learning team, including supervising and supporting team members, performance planning and evaluation, determining staffing needs, resolving interdepartmental conflicts, developing annual budgets, and determining training needs.
- In collaboration with the CCO, establishes the strategic direction of WealthCounsel's Learning programs; executes this strategy in continuous collaboration with company leadership and the Operations, Growth, Content, and Finance teams.
- Oversees all programs related to WealthCounsel members’ practice development with a focus on WealthCounsel growth and retention strategies to increase revenue.
- In coordination with the Growth and Membership Experience teams, contributes to WealthCounsel growth and retention initiatives by implementing innovative learning initiatives.
- Engages with members and prospects to assist in determining practice development and substantive legal education needs and priorities.
- Works closely with the Learning team and the Director of Learning Operations to build and deliver a comprehensive annual education plan and education calendar to ensure WealthCounsel consistently delivers relevant substantive and practice development education to members and prospects.
- Coordinates all programming related to education events, including but not limited to Symposium, the Advanced Estate Planning Summit, and the Academy of Special Needs Planners (ASNP) National Conference.
- Responsible for the vision and direction of the Quarterly magazine.
- Oversees the Learning team’s review of all substantive and practice building content submitted by contractors, speakers, instructors, and all other contributors, including marketing pieces from the Marketing and Legal Marketing team.
- Creates product concept proposals and business cases to support the development of new educational offerings, including applying best practices in lifelong learning, monetization of offerings, and innovative delivery of education through new and different media, program length and program focus.
- Actively engages in collecting competitive intelligence to ensure WealthCounsel’s educational programming remains cutting edge and the best value in the market.
- Actively engages with the Legal Content Team to develop and execute overarching strategy and plan to connect WealthCounsel’s software offerings with education.
- Teaches and writes on substantive topics, current developments, and practice building.
- Ensures compliance with industry best practices and company processes and procedures.

Here’s what you’ll need to be successful in this role:
- Juris Doctor (JD) from an accredited law school; experience as a WealthCounsel member preferred.
- At least 10 years of industry-related experience, including a minimum of three years in an upper management role.
- 5-10 years experience practicing estate planning.
- Experience teaching programs related to WealthCounsel’s core products or law firm practice building strategies.
- Demonstrated ability to effectively coordinate professional education events in-person and virtually.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with a proven ability to improve business processes and practices to reduce costs and increase efficiency.
- Ability to identify and implement best practices and continual performance measurement.
- Excellent interpersonal and negotiation skills.
-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ail.
- Strong supervisory and leadership skills.
- Demonstrated ability to lead a team of non-centralized employees to meet deadlines and consistently deliver high-quality strategic plans and content.
- Willingness to regularly teach, present, and write required.
- Travel required, including to conferences and WealthCounsel member meetings.
